Struct DropletsListBackupsResponseBackupsItem 

Source
pub struct DropletsListBackupsResponseBackupsItem {
    pub created_at: DateTime<Utc>,
    pub id: i64,
    pub min_disk_size: i64,
    pub name: String,
    pub regions: Vec<String>,
    pub size_gigabytes: f32,
    pub type_: DropletsListBackupsResponseBackupsItemType,
}

Fields§

§created_at: DateTime<Utc>

A time value given in ISO8601 combined date and time format that represents when the snapshot was created.

§id: i64

The unique identifier for the snapshot or backup.

§min_disk_size: i64

The minimum size in GB required for a volume or Droplet to use this snapshot.

§name: String

A human-readable name for the snapshot.

§regions: Vec<String>

An array of the regions that the snapshot is available in. The regions are represented by their identifying slug values.

§size_gigabytes: f32§type_: DropletsListBackupsResponseBackupsItemType

Describes the kind of image. It may be one of snapshot or backup. This specifies whether an image is a user-generated Droplet snapshot or automatically created Droplet backup.
